What’s good about the Nikon D7100

Best price $785
  • 73% more battery life 950 shots vs 550 shots
  • Higher sensor resolution 24.1 MP vs 14.2 MP
  • Higher resolution rear screen 1226k dots vs 230k dots
  • Better light sensitivity by 1 f-stop 25,600 ISO vs 12,800 ISO
  • Newer camera March 2013 vs September 2010
  • Better video capture 1080p 30fps vs 1080p 24fps
  • Faster continuous shooting speed 6 shots per sec vs 3 shots per sec
  • Has HDR on-board D3100 does not have HDR
  • Has an External Mic jack D3100 does not

What’s good about the Nikon D3100

Best price
$364
  • Weighs a little bit less than the D7100 16 oz vs 23.8 oz
  • Smaller body size 54 in³ vs 67 in³
  • Significantly cheaper street price $364 vs $785
